Barbara
Gruber, M.A. and Sue Gruber, M.A. have developed and presented
seminars for teachers nationwide.
They've written dozens of resource books for elementary teachers
and are published by Frank Schaffer Publications, Inc, The Education
Center, Teach Now, and Practice and LearnRight. They are a mother-daughter
team who share a passion for writing, teaching children, and working
with teachers.
Barbara
Gruber is best known for writing resource books and presenting
seminars for K-6 teachers nationwide. Barbara and Sue
wrote the Instant Idea Books series for Frank Schaffer Publications
which included twenty-four books. That series of books, along
with Barbara's best selling 100% Practical book, are used in classrooms
every day. She also writes reproducible curriculum materials for
K-6 students. Teachers across the country know Barbara from the
curriculum and classroom management seminars she presented nationwide
for Frank Schaffer Publications. For fifteen years, she presented
one-day seminars to over 10,000 teachers each year. Teachers flocked
to the seminars because they were practical and filled with so
many wonderful ideas. Barbara has years of experience as a classroom
teacher and is a reading specialist. She excels at helping teachers
use educationally-sound ideas in ways that excite today's children.
And, she helps teachers have "a life beyond teaching."
Recently, she created the complete series of Word Wall products
for Practice and LearnRight. Her book "How to Use Word Walls"
is a best-seller nationwide. Barbara lives on a farm in northern
California with two cats, two dogs and her husband who is a grape
grower. Barbara loves offering courses online because she can
continue her favorite endeavor - working with teachers everywhere.
Sue
Gruber is currently a kindergarten teacher in northern California.
She has taught the third, fourth, and fifth grades. Sue offered to help Barbara write a science
book for Frank Schaffer Publications. That was her first experience
working on a book. She discovered she had a knack for writing
and brainstorming ideas with Barbara! Hence, a mother-daughter
writing team was launched. Barbara was thrilled to have a writing
partner and Sue was eager to learn the craft of writing for teachers.
Since then, they've written dozens of idea books and curriculum
products together. Sue frequently does presentations in her school
district sharing ideas with teachers. For six years, Sue presented
summer seminars for K-6 teachers for Frank Schaffer Publications.
Sue, her husband and son live in Sonoma County.
